Murder Diaries: Ankara
Drops players into a gripping thriller where a captured serial killer’s blood-written diary leads investigators to an abandoned mental hospital. Commissioner Tahir, haunted by the killer’s final clues, unknowingly walks into danger as he’s struck down mid-escape. Waking up inside the decaying hospital, he must navigate pitch-black corridors filled with supernatural threats while piecing together the mystery. The game blends intense FPS action with a chilling atmosphere, challenging players to hunt down ghostly entities and solve puzzles to survive. With nine chapters, *Murder Diaries: Ankara* offers a mix of standard FPS mechanics and narrative-driven horror. Players can toggle pixel-based retro visuals for nostalgic appeal or experience the full story in modern graphics. An early access TPS mode adds depth, letting fans explore the eerie environment from multiple angles. The narrative’s twist—where the commissioner becomes both hunter and prey—keeps players engaged until the final reveal. Developed by an indie.
